From as far back as the 1960s much focus was positioned on vibrant colour in the washroom. Formed wall surface tiles of maritime animals as well as over-the-top colours were the fad, in addition to plastic. Plastic restroom décor was the craze, from vibrant orange, olive eco-friendly, mustard yellow and also chocolate brownish coloured toothbrush, soap and also towel owners, to thick patterned plastic shower drapes that shrieked colours of the boldest nature.
As the times moved on, the 1970s and also early 1980s came to be a duration when gold restroom fixings as well as furnishing, such as faucets, towel rails and toilet roll owners, were thought about really elegant. These ostentatious gold cut functions were in vogue, as well as bathroom design was 'loud'. Added to this were those when delightful shower room suites in colours avocado, reefs pink, and delicious chocolate brown. Washroom colour has transformed drastically over the past years, as well as tones have come to be much more neutral, occasionally with a hint of colour that includes a complementary vigour to the general system.
Of the many numerous individuals who participated in Plumbworld's recent restroom study, an overwhelming 82 percent claimed they "disliked" the as soon as glorified avocado as well as reefs pink restroom suites, colours remnant of 1970s as well as 1980s, which are commonly characterised as being dark and also dull.
According to the survey, chrome shower room taps were much chosen to gold.
So, when making and embellishing your washroom keep those dark colours away, take into consideration white suites, as well as select chrome fixings as well as home furnishings instead of flashy gold.

Shower power


When preparing the layout of your bathroom, one of one of the most vital aspects to consider is putting a shower. Some washrooms don't have sufficient area to consist of a shower work area, so assess your options. Think about mounting a shower over the bathroom if room is limited.
The survey showed that 94 percent of its individuals thought that a shower in a washroom was really important, and 81 per cent stated they liked a different shower unit in a huge bathroom. Nearly 65 percent claimed their perfect would certainly be a power shower, while 27 percent preferred mixer showers, and only 12 per cent chose electric showers.
If you have selected a shower over the bath, then consider putting a set glass display rather than a shower drape. It might set you back a couple of additional pounds, however over half of the study's contributors liked a fixed glass screen to a shower curtain.

Selecting your bath tub


As opposed to typical belief, adding a whirlpool bath to increase residential or commercial property value doesn't always do the trick. So if you're pondering marketing your building, attempt to stay clear of buying a whirlpool bath in the hopes of acquiring additional profit.
The survey disclosed that near 53 per cent of its participants were not phased by them, while just a tiny 38 percent of participants "loved" them. Remarkably, 62 percent stated they had "no strong view" towards edge bathrooms either, which indicates the conventional rectangular baths still hold authority versus their improved counter parts.

Bathroom floor covering


Attempt to prevent the urge to position carpetings on the shower room floor, according to the survey it is not also favoured. The study showed that the recommended flooring covering was ceramic tiles, with 75 per cent claiming they "liked" a tiled restroom floor. Popular plastic flooring has not yet shed its location in the bathroom, with greater than 61 per cent saying they really did not have any solid sort or dislikes in the direction of it.
When selecting your restroom floor covering, floor tiles is the favoured choice, but if the spending plan is tight, after that plastic flooring will not let you down.
Apart from the floor covering, ensure your home windows look appealing. When it pertains to dressing your shower room windows, stay away from those restroom nets as well as fabric drapes. The survey revealed that 94 per cent claimed they favoured blinds in the restroom to drapes.

Keep it tidy


If you are preparing to place your house on the market, check your bathroom for those little generally undetected flaws, like mould on the silicone sealer around the bath, as well as even on your shower drape if you have one. Potential buyers may observe these small mistakes, which could send out after that running!

HOW MUCH DO BATHROOMS AND KITCHEN RENOVATIONS IMPACT YOUR HOME’S VALUE?


How will a bathroom or kitchen renovation impact the resale value of your home?



Based on data from the market, a kitchen upgrade will add between 60-80% of the project cost to the value of the home when the property is sold. Midrange kitchen renovations fetched a higher return on investment (ROI), averaging around 80%, while upper-end bathroom renovations resulted in around a 60% improvement to the value of the home.



Conversely, a bathroom renovation will add between 60-67% of the project’s cost to the home’s resale value. As with kitchen renovations, midrange upgrades outperform upper-end bathroom projects. For midrange renovations, homeowners were able to recoup 67.2% of their costs, while they only regained 60.2% of the costs from more expensive renovations.



But this does not necessarily mean that renovating the kitchen is better than renovating the bathrooms. This is because kitchen renovations cost more than bathroom renovations.


Several factors determine if your home will benefit more from a bathroom renovation or a kitchen renovation. Kitchens are more visible than bathrooms, so visitors are more likely to see them. But you also spend more time than you realize in your bathroom, and renovating it will take less money out of your pocket.



If you have difficulties deciding which project will make the most impact, speaking with an experienced real estate agent can help. That is because the value-add of a bathroom or kitchen renovation also depends on the location. Some locations value one type of renovation over the other. Talking to an agent who knows the market will give you some valuable insights.



Whether you choose to renovate the kitchen, bathroom, or both, the agent can also help you determine which specific areas of the rooms you should focus on.
